iOS Swift Collections and Control Flow Control Flow With Loops Working With Loops

I don't understand how to use counter as an index value.

I am a little confused on how to go about this question, didn't really understand the first question either just got lucky. I am also curious on if there are any resources on these.

loops.swift
let numbers = [2,8,1,16,4,3,9]
var sum = 0
var counter = 0

// Enter your code below
while counter < numbers.count { 
    sum += numbers[counter]
    counter += 1
}

1 Answer

Kyle Vandeven
Kyle Vandeven
11,697 Points
let numbers = [2,8,1,16,4,3,9]
var sum = 0
var counter = 0

// Enter your code below


while counter < numbers.count {
    sum = sum + numbers[counter] 
    counter += 1


}

this is great but I was hoping for some further explination.